This makes them appealing to do-it-yourselfers. If... Step 9: The foundation is poured in this construction step to build a new house. Your home will have one of three types of foundation: slab foundation. a crawlspace. a full basement poured or constructed. The concrete is cured to reach maximum strength, taking anywhere from 28 to 60 days based on weather conditions. Choose your finish then multiply by the regional variations table below to …Apr 5, 2023 · Cost to Plumb a New House. The cost to plumb a new 2,000-square-foot home with 2 or 3 baths is $8,000 to $12,000 on average. New plumbing installation costs depend on: The type of materials used. How many levels the house has. The number of bathrooms and plumbing fixtures. How far apart the bathrooms are.
